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Description
Hundreds of soft, charming, tiny cushions suffused with color. Very showy in borders, or massed in drifts. Plants are rigid and tough. Start indoors 6 weeks before last frost. Blue Horizon is a tall variety that's great for either beds or cuts. 30" high, spreads 12-15", with 3-4" blue clusters.
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Blooming
Flowers will bloom in summer and can be blue, lavender, lilac, mauve, pink or white.
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Growth
Germination should occur within two or three days. Ageratums will grow to be about 6-8 in. tall with an 8-10 in. spread.
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Planting
Plant seeds 8 inches apart. Planting medium should be disease-free and have a pH of between 5.5 and 5.8. They do best in full sun, but can be grown in 50% sun to prevent drying or browning in particularly warm, dry areas.
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Pest
Ageratums are susceptible to slugs, snails, aphids and whiteflies.

Flossflower (Ageratum houstonianum 'Blue Horizon Hybrid') - Soil and irrigation
Ageratums require rich, moist soil that is well-draining and slightly acidic. During the first week, water the plant daily. After that, water plant when needed.
